like 为什么会导致索引失效呢?
java吧
全部回复
仅看楼主
level 7
建立一个name索引;
插入2000条数据; 查询name like 'a%' 不走索引;删除900条后,like‘a%’ 又走索引。
有没有人解释一下什么原因?
2022年04月18日 03点04分 1
level 7
这跟我们平时得到的结论不相符呀?
2022年04月18日 03点04分 2
level 8
和数据量有关,走二级索引要回表,引擎觉得还不如直接走主键索引
2022年04月18日 04点04分 3
level 8
大哥能帮忙内推一下嘛[小乖][小乖]
2022年10月23日 02点10分 4
level 8
同问
2022年10月24日 03点10分 5
level 11
2000条数据 name是一样的吗?应该是你的name区分度不够,用索引要回表,不如不用索引了
2022年10月24日 03点10分 6
level 9
msql 认为全表扫比你走索引快
2022年10月25日 03点10分 8
1